The 2024 California Community College Student Affairs Association (CCCSAA) Professional Development Conference will be held June 12 through 14 at the luxurious The Biltmore Los Angeles hotel. Individuals serving or desiring to serve in roles as student advisors, conduct administrators, social justice change agents, basic needs coordinators, and student affairs practitioners are encouraged to attend this three-day conference. The conference will focus on key areas such as Student Success, Guided Pathways, Basic Needs, Mental Health, Health Services, Student Conduct, upcoming legislation, and more, highlighting the latest initiatives and strategies being implemented to support students across the California Community College system. Attendees will have the opportunity to engage with the panelists through a Q&A session, where they can ask questions and share insights on how to further enhance support for community college students.
This year’s keynote speaker will be Jasmin Brett Stringer, author, speaker, and career coach known for her work in empowering individuals to pursue their passions and achieve their career goals. She is the author of the book "Seize Your Life: How to Carpe Diem Every Day," which offers insights and strategies for living a more fulfilling and purpose-driven life. The closing speaker this year will be the honorable Shirley N. Weber, Ph.D., California Secretary of State. Weber is California’s first Black Secretary of State and only the fifth African American to serve as a state constitutional officer in California’s 173-year history. Weber’s genuine passion and tireless quest for equality and fairness in all sectors of life have resulted in her pursuit of reforms in education and criminal justice.
Through immersive discussions and workshops, attendees will explore a theoretical framework essential for navigating the multifaceted realm of social justice issues, emerging as adept advocates for equity and inclusion on their campuses.
